普通及合并白癜风的HBV感染者血清抗TRP-1抗体的检测及其临床意义分析 被引量:1

目的检测普通及合并白癜风的HBV感染者血清抗酪氨酸酶相关蛋白-1自身抗体(autoantibodies to tyrosinaserelated protein-1,a-TRP-1)水平并分析其临床意义。方法选取白癜风患者126例(其中合并HBV感染8例,合并a-TPO、a-TG阳性34例,其他... 目的检测普通及合并白癜风的HBV感染者血清抗酪氨酸酶相关蛋白-1自身抗体(autoantibodies to tyrosinaserelated protein-1,a-TRP-1)水平并分析其临床意义。方法选取白癜风患者126例(其中合并HBV感染8例,合并a-TPO、a-TG阳性34例,其他白癜风病84例);无白癜风病史的普通HBV感染者84例(Hbs Ag、Hbe Ag、Hbc Ab阳性24例,Hbs Ag、Hbe Ab、Hbc Ab阳性60例);乙肝抗体阳性对照者96例(Hbs Ab、Hbe Ab、Hbc Ab阳性48例,Hbs Ab阳性48例);乙肝五项全阴性的健康对照者96例。用ELISA法和细胞免疫荧光法检测所有标本a-TRP-1表达水平,并对结果进行统计分析。结果白癜风组a-TRP-1总阳性率为6.3%(8/126),其中合并HBV感染者、合并a-TPO及a-TG阳性者、其他白癜风患者a-TRP-1浓度为分别为948.2±68.3 U/m L、36.1±0.1U/m L、54.3±12.8U/m L,各组阳性率分别为100%(8/8)、0%(0/34)、0%(0/84);健康对照组为46.9±0.1U/m L,阳性率为0%(0/96)。白癜风组中合并HBV感染者与健康对照组抗体浓度比较,差异有统计学意义(P<0.01),而a-TPO、a-TG阳性者、其他白癜风患者与健康对照组比较差异无统计学意义(P>0.05)。普通HBV感染组中,Hbs Ag、Hbe Ag、Hbc Ab阳性者与Hbs Ag、Hbe Ab、Hbc Ab阳性者a-TRP-1浓度分别为868.7±161.4U/m L、756.7±157.5U/m L,阳性率分别为91.7%(22/24)、85.0%(51/60),与健康对照组比较,差异均有统计学意义(P<0.01);乙肝抗体阳性对照组中Hbs Ab、Hbe Ab、Hbc Ab阳性者与Hbs Ab阳性者分别为26.8±0.1U/m L、33.3±0.1U/m L,阳性率分别为0%(0/48)、0%(0/48),与健康对照组比较,差异均无统计学意义(P>0.05)。细胞免疫荧光法检测结果显示,ELISA法检测的a-TRP-1抗体阳性血清与黑素细胞培养固定物反应后,在胞浆和胞膜处发出明亮荧光,荧光强度+++^++++,合并a-TPO、a-TG阳性及部分其他白癜风患者血清在胞膜处也有荧光,荧光强度约++,健康对照血清荧光暗淡或无荧光。结论 a-TRP-1抗体的高表达与HBV感染有密切关系,该抗体应该不是大部分白癜风患者具有代表性的血清标志物,在大部分没有白癜风的普通HBV感染者体内也可高水平存在,这可能是该类患者继发白癜风的预兆和重要原因。 展开更多

AstragalosideⅣimproves melanocyte differentiation from mouse bone marrow mesenchymal stem cells

Vitiligo results in an autoimmune disorder destructing skin pigment cells,melanocytes(Mcs).This study aimed to investigate whether Astragaloside IV(AIV)could efficiently induce differentiation of bone marrow mesenchymal stem cells(BMMSCs)into Mcs.BMMSCs were induced and differentiated into Mcs with 0.1,0.2,and 0.4 mg/L AIV during 150-day.Morphologic changes of differentiated cells were observed.Levels of some melanocytic specific genes(TRP-1,TRP-2,MART-1,Mitf)were measured with quantitative polymerase chain reaction(qPCR)at 90,120,and 150 days of induction.After 90-day induction,the differentiated cells with 0.4 mg/L AIV demonstrated the typical morphology of Mcs,positive 3,4 dihydroxyphenylalanine staining,and positive staining of TRP-1,TRP-2,MART-1,and Mitf.After 90-and 120-days’induction with 0.4 mg/L AIV,TRP-1 expression was significantly elevated(p<0.01),and TRP-2 expression was significantly increased in 0.4 mg/L AIV-treated group compared to negative control(p<0.01),0.1 mg/L(p<0.01),and 0.2 mg/L(p<0.01)AIV-treated groups.Moreover,MART-1 expression was significantly up-regulated in 0.4 mg/L AIV-treated group compared to negative control,but without difference compared to 0.1 mg/L(p>0.05)and 0.2 mg/L(p>0.05)AIV-treated groups.During 90 to 150-day induction,there were no significant differences for Mitf levels between AIV-treated groups and negative control(p>0.05).In conclusion,90-day induction with 0.4 mg/L AIV up-regulated TRP-1,TRP-2,and MART-1 expression,indicating that AIV can efficiently induce Mcs differentiation from BMMSCs.These results provide experimental and theoretic evidence for AIV application in clinical vitiligo repigmentation treatment. 展开更多
